ElkArte Community

Project Support => General ElkArte discussions => Topic started by: emanuele on January 01, 2017, 05:42:14 pm

Title: Preparing the battlefield
Post by: emanuele on January 01, 2017, 05:42:14 pm
While I was in good mood, I started working on the very first step for 2.0: kill any kind of backward compatibility. YAY! :D

https://github.com/elkarte/Elkarte/compare/development...emanuele45:remove_1-x_compat?expand=1
Almost 2000 lines of code dropped! YAY! :D
/me likes remove code! It makes the code cleaner!

Now I found this topic (http://www.elkarte.net/community/index.php?topic=2084.msg28874#msg28874) where it was quickly decided that 5.5 should be the minimum version of php, so I removed also anything I was able to find that was there to keep the code compatible with 5.2, 5.3, 5.4. YAY! :D

/me now goes back working on releasing 1.1 O:-)
Title: Re: Preparing the battlefield
Post by: live627 on January 01, 2017, 05:54:30 pm
INCOMING!!
Title: Re: Preparing the battlefield
Post by: Spuds on January 01, 2017, 07:03:44 pm
I'll be SO glad to have all those depreciated things gone gone gone :D
Title: Re: Preparing the battlefield
Post by: ahrasis on January 01, 2017, 07:04:39 pm
Focus only on using php 5.5, 5.6, 7.0 & 7.1 in 1.1 to 2.0. That should be good.
Title: Re: Preparing the battlefield
Post by: live627 on January 01, 2017, 07:41:06 pm
Quote from: Spuds – I'll be SO glad to have all those depreciated things gone gone gone :D
So will Scrutinizer.
Title: Re: Preparing the battlefield
Post by: Spuds on January 01, 2017, 07:45:53 pm
And my IDE
Title: Re: Preparing the battlefield
Post by: Jorin on January 02, 2017, 06:43:05 am
Quote from: emanuele – While I was in good mood, I started working on the very first step for 2.0: kill any kind of backward compatibility. YAY! :D

Don't forget to add some lines of buggy code instead!  :D
Title: Re: Preparing the battlefield
Post by: emanuele on January 02, 2017, 07:00:48 am
There is plenty of time for that!! D:
Title: Re: Preparing the battlefield
Post by: elk_is_cool on January 02, 2017, 09:54:49 pm
And think SEO...and "Friendly URL's"......
myforum .com/discussion/elkarte-is-number-one   <<<Google loves that. Easy for humans to figure out too!
Title: Re: Preparing the battlefield
Post by: kucing on January 03, 2017, 09:48:07 pm
Quote from: elk_is_cool – And think SEO...and "Friendly URL's"......
myforum .com/discussion/elkarte-is-number-one   <<<Google loves that. Easy for humans to figure out too!

to be honest i'm pretty used to the ugly one. :P but it won't hurt to have one, some will need it and if possible it's customizable like wordpress permalink.

a sitemap generator is good too. now i'm using rss feed in google search console.

but this thread is not for feature request. :D